An online fundraiser is trying to bring in money to support the owner of a kitesurfing business in Marin County that burned in a fire earlier this week.
The fire was reported at 3:20 a.m. Tuesday at 44 Industrial Way in unincorporated Greenbrae, the address of the business Live2Kite that sells equipment for kitesurfing and other watersports, according to the Central Marin Fire Department. The fire was declared under control about two hours later.
The owner of the business, Evan Vangelis Mavridoglou, “lost everything” in the fire, according to a GoFundMe account set up by a friend at https://www.gofundme.com/f/support-evans-journey-to-rebuild. The account had raised more than $3,300 as of Thursday afternoon…
